打破互通障碍 开放容器倡议组织发布标准

OCI推出发布规范项目,要进一步建立强固通用的标准,在原生云端环境和容器生态系中,确保一致性以及容器的互操作性。

开放容器倡议组织(Open Container Initiative,OCI)要制定映像档发布标准,打破各容器管理平台的互通障碍。OCI启动发布规范项目,以Docker Registry v2协议为基础,订立容器映像档推送与拉取等行为的发布标准。

由Docker、IBM、微软、红帽及Google等厂商组成,负责建立容器标准的开源社群OCI,在2016年时怕标准遭特定厂商绑定,共同推出了OCI Runtime标准,并且规范容器映像档建立、认证、签署以及命名的方式。在2017年这个标准成熟后推出了OCI 1.0。

不过,虽然容器映像档格式有了标准,但各家厂商却把脑筋动到了管理平台上,用自家的容器映像档管理平台标准绑住使用者,因此现在OCI推出发布规范项目,要进一步建立强固通用的标准,在原生云端环境和容器生态系中,确保一致性以及容器的互操作性。而由于Docker Registry v2协议,已经被社群广泛接受遵循,因此最新的规范,便会基于这个既存的协定。

容器发布规范在GitHub上的提案,只有发布API的规范,并不包含Docker Registry的程序代码,不过Docker Registry则被当作参照实作,该协议还有其他非开源的实作,包括Google的gcr.io、Amazon ECR、CoreOS Quay、Gitlab registry,JFrog Artifactory registry、华为Dockyard等。

提案中指出,过去社群在讨论OCI规范的时候,碰触到映像文件发布主题,总会以先定义映像档格式,先满足产业需求在说。而现在Docker Registry v2协议,已是公认的OCI映像档格式,未来或许会有其他更好的做法,但暂且就当作推送和拉取映像档的产业发布规范的基础。

Docker工程师兼OCI技术监督委员会主席Michael Crosby表示,Docker Registry已经是Runtime与映像档的公认标准,有超过400亿个拉取的映像档遵循这个协议发布。

OCI联盟执行总监Chris Aniszczyk表示,随着云端技术以及容器技术的发展,社群需要一个可靠的发布标准,以提高互操作性,而OCI扮演中立角色来发展规范。另外,该提案也提供容器生态系讨论以及排程,来扩充映像档发布规范。
文章出自:咖啡大师品咖啡 http://herhon.com.tw/

转载于:https://my.oschina.net/u/3772040/blog/1795264

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值